"Great location in downtown Blue Ridge. Just know that the hotel is right across the road from the Blue Ridge Scenic Railway so when the train leaves in the morning you will hear the horn and the engine. Fortunately, it only ran a few days of the week when were there in mid-July so we only heard it on one morning. We love the train so that was part of the allure for us. "We checked in and the first room had what appeared to be mold all over the bathroom, inside the little closet, and underneath the AC unit. When we brought it up to the front desk, the guy kept arguing with us that it wasn’t mold and was “just a water leak.” Regardless of what it was, it was clearly unacceptable and not something anyone should have to stay around.
